Coming to Digital on May 14, 2019, and then to
Blu-Ray and DVD on May 21,019 from Universal Pictures Home Entertainment is The
Upside. The Upside is directed by Neil Burger who brought Limitless and stars
Kevin Hart ( Ride Along), Bryan Cranston (Breaking Bad), Nicole Kidman
(Aquaman), Golshifteh Farahani (Paterson), Julianna Margulies (ER), Aja Naomi
King (The Birth of a Nation), and Tate
Donovan (Argo).
A recently paroled ex-convict, Dell strikes up an unusual and unlikely friendship with a quadriplegic, Philip Lacasse in this
“funny and warm-hearted buddy comedy”. From worlds apart, Dell and Philip form
an unlikely bond, bridging their differences and gaining invaluable wisdom in
the process, giving each man a renewed sense of passion for all of life’s
possibilities; Inspired by a true story.
BONUS
FEATURES ON BLU-RAY, DVD, AND DIGITAL
Deleted
Scenes
Gag
Reel
Onscreen
Chemistry: Kevin and Bryan – Film stars Kevin Hart and Bryan Cranston
talk about their unique characters and working together on The Upside.
Creating
a Story of Possibility – Kevin Hart and Bryan Cranston share insight on
how their characters, Dell Scott and Phillip Lacasse, unexpectedly come
together to help each other unlock a new world of possibilities.
Bridging
Divisions – Director Neil Burger and Kevin Hart talk about how two
very different people find common ground through compassion for each other.
Embracing
Positivity – Kevin Hart and Bryan Cranston open up about positive messages
in the film and the power of hope, love, and friendship.
Presenting
a Different Side of Kevin Hart – Neil Burger, Kevin Hart, and Bryan
Cranston discusses Kevin’s career-changing role and his fantastic performance.
Theatrical
Trailer
